Output 4c696b50e5434acb07ca48d8581ebffca86ebe027bb045bc0af26441eee05abc:27

value
690954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64055a5512fd41c05e6d9bb1168a406028024aff OP_EQUAL
address
3Aosuef6cCnfpNrofNN6mk7vE6u4L32Yay
transaction
4c696b50e5434acb07ca48d8581ebffca86ebe027bb045bc0af26441eee05abc
confirmations
1015
spent
true